Possible Causes of Smoke Damage to Drywall

Smoke damage to drywall often occurs after a fire incident, whether small or large. When smoke from a fire penetrates walls, it leaves behind stubborn soot and odor, making the affected drywall look stained and feel contaminated. Even minor fires or cooking accidents can cause smoke particles to settle deep into the drywall material, leading to long-lasting damage if not addressed promptly.

In addition to actual fires, smoke can also result from electrical malfunctions or appliance failures that produce smoke without an open flame. Over time, these incidents can cause gradual smoke buildup, especially in areas with poor ventilation. This accumulation not only damages the drywall’s appearance but can also pose health risks if left untreated. Recognizing the cause early helps our team determine the best restoration approach for your home or business.

How We Can Fix Smoke-Damaged Drywall

Our experts begin by thoroughly assessing the extent of the smoke damage. We identify all affected areas, paying close attention to soot deposits and lingering odors that standard cleaning might not remove. Once the assessment is complete, we develop a tailored remediation plan designed to restore your drywall efficiently and effectively.

Our team uses advanced cleaning techniques to remove soot and smoke residues from drywall surfaces. For surfaces with stubborn stains or deep-seated soot, we employ specialized cleaning agents that break down contaminants without harming the drywall. When necessary, we replace severely damaged sections to ensure a seamless, clean finish that matches your existing walls.

Restoration also involves addressing residual odors. We utilize professional-grade ozone treatments and thermally activated deodorization to eliminate smoke smells completely. Is drywall replacement always necessary after fire damage?

Not necessarily. If the drywall only has superficial soot and smoke staining, cleaning and deodorizing might suffice. However, if the drywall is deeply stained, structurally compromised, or contains lingering odors, replacement is the most effective solution to ensure safety and long-term cleanliness.
